Release checklist — Farecraft rules engine. Before shipping, replay the full regression corpus of shipping-fee scenarios, including the Westholm zone overrides and the dimensional-weight edge cases added last quarter. Confirm that rule precedence is deterministic by running the corpus twice and diffing outputs; any variance blocks release. Document which ruleset version was active during validation, since fee disputes often arrive weeks later. Finally, record the validated build so audits can reconstruct exactly what shipped, as noted below.

session token of tajef-bageg = htk21_5d90d574934f3ccae6437

**Vendor note: Inkmill markdown pipeline**

Rendering for Parchway docs is outsourced to Inkmill under an annual contract, renewing each March. They handle sanitization and PDF export; we own the upload queue. SLA: 4-hour response on rendering failures. Escalate only after two failed retries. Their support desk is reachable at the address below.

billing contact of hahaf-baguf = zorael.tammir.jorius@sivrelhq.internal

## Onboarding: Farebranch Rules Engine

Plugin authors integrate with Farebranch by registering fee rules against the evaluation API. Rules are sandboxed; they cannot perform network calls directly. All rate-table lookups go through the host, which validates your plugin manifest at load time. Your local env file must include the signing credential the host uses to verify manifests, set on the next line.

secret setting of bajef-fajof: COURIER_KEY3=76c